LaDainian Tomlinson at NFL combine: 5-10, 222, 4.46 40-yard dash
Ray Rice at NFL combine: 5-8, 199 pounds, 4.42 40
Sione Palelei at LSU camp: 5-9, 202 pounds, 4.45 40.
Sounds like he fits the mold of what Cameron is looking for. Low center of gravity, but strong. Great ball skills. Ability to make people miss in space.
Palelei is the perfect Cameron back.
Of course, Fournette is the perfect back in any scheme. His 40 is probably the same as Palelei. His ball skills are the same. Fournette is just a freak.
